Description

With high-end communication modules, robust power options, security and processing power, this ExpLoRer can play a crucial aspect of your next IoT project.

Combining a BLE (RN4871) 4.2 module alongside a LoRa (RN2483A) chip will provide a seamless experience that offers effective communication between a wide range of devices. The well-known LoRa® technology has provided solutions in a multitude of domains – from air pollution monitoring to item location and even smart parking, this technology can be used to its fullest potential when equipped with an effective board such as the SODAQ ExpLoRer.

Alongside the communication features, the board additionally can be powered through an on-board solar charge controller – just connect a solar panel, and you’re ready to go! Solar power, not your thing? No problem, the board additionally supports LiPo batteries and USB power.

Security is essential and is required in almost every project that involves sending and receiving data. To secure your projects, the ExpLoRer board has a built-in ATECC508A crypto chip. This ensures your projects will be able to support the latest developments and their required high-end security protocols. This technology is able to protect your confidentiality and data integrity through their “ultra-secure hardware-based cryptographic key storage.”

Lastly, size can be the determining factor in your projects. With a small form factor of 93 x 55 mm (matchbox-sized), this device is certainly not getting in the way. Although relatively small, it packs a punch and will fit right into your setup as a powerful tool with a small form factor.

Specifications

Technical details

Features:

  • Atmel SAMD21, 32 bits Arm Cortex M0 microcontroller
  • Microchip: RN2483A / RN2903
  • Microchip RN4871 Bluetooth 4.2 module (BLE) with ceramic antenna
  • Atmel ATECC508A1 crypto chip to securely store your LoRa keys.
  • Atmel SST25PF040C serial flash chip (4Mbit)
  • MCP 73831 Charge controller and on-board rechargeable coin cell battery
  • embedded (PCB) LoRa antenna
  • MCP97001 temperature sensor
  • RGB LED
  • Micro USB Connector

Specifications

  • Microcontroller: ATSAMD21J18, 32-Bit ARM Cortex M0+
  • Compatibility: Arduino M0 Compatible
  • Size: 93 x 55 mm
  • Operating Voltage: 3.3V
  • I/O Pins: 20
  • Analog Output Pin: 10-bit DAC
  • External Interrupts: Available on all pins
  • DC Current per I/O pin: 7 mA
  • Flash Memory: 256 KB and 4MB (external flash)
  • SRAM: 32KB
  • EEPROM: Up to 16KB by emulation
  • Clock Speed: 48 MHz
  • Power: 5V USB power and/or 3.7 LiPo battery
  • Charging: Solar charge controller, up to 500mA charge current
  • LED: RGB LED, Blue LED
  • LoRa Microchip: RN2483A / RN2903 Module
  • Bluetooth Microchip: RN4871 Module
  • Cyptochip : ATECC508A
  • Temperature sensor: MCP9700AT
  • USB: MicroUSB Port
